About Permata Bank
PermataBank, officially known as PT Bank Permata Tbk, stands as a formidable pillar in the Indonesian financial landscape. With a lineage tracing back to 1955 as PT Bank Bali, the institution has navigated decades of economic shifts to emerge as a premier commercial bank. Meaning and History of the PermataBank Logo
The genesis of the current PermataBank logo occurred during a pivotal moment in the company's history: the 2002 major acquisition and restructuring. Prior to this, the institution operated as Bank Bali. When Standard Chartered Bank and PT Astra International Tbk acquired majority stakes, a rebranding was essential to signal a new era of governance and modernization. The name "Permata" was chosen to signify preciousness, durability, and high value.
The meaning behind the visual identity is deeply rooted in the concept of the "flowering gem." The emblem is designed to look like a stylized lotus flower composed of diamond or crystal facets. In Asian culture, the lotus represents purity and rebirth, while the gem facets allude to the bank's name. This dual symbolism suggests that PermataBank is an institution that nurtures growth (the flower) while maintaining rock-solid financial strength (the gem). The logo was crafted to communicate that the bank is a precious partner in the customer's financial journey.
The Evolution of the Symbol
Tracing the history of the PermataBank logo requires looking back at its predecessor, Bank Bali. The original branding was reflective of the mid-20th century, focusing on traditional corporate solidity. However, the transformation into PermataBank in 2002 marked a radical departure from conservative aesthetics to a more vibrant, modern look. Over the last two decades, the logo has seen subtle refinements rather than drastic overhauls, maintaining the integrity of the original 2002 design.
As the bank moved towards digitalization—highlighted by its 2019 partnership with BCA and the subsequent interest from Bangkok Bank—the symbol has been optimized for digital platforms. The vector usage of the logo has become more prominent, ensuring the emblem remains crisp and recognizable on mobile banking apps and high-definition screens. The consistency of this emblem during times of acquisition rumors and strategic shifts demonstrates the strength of the brand's foundation.
Design Elements & Typography
From a design historian's perspective, the PermataBank logo achieves a balance between geometric precision and organic approachability. The emblem features petal-like shapes arranged in a radial symmetry, drawing the eye inward to a central focal point. This arrangement suggests unity and focus. The petals are not sharply pointed but have softened edges, making the brand appear approachable and customer-friendly rather than rigid.
The typography used alongside the emblem plays a crucial role in the branding strategy. The name "PermataBank" is typically rendered in a clean, humanist sans-serif typeface. The font choice eschews serifs to avoid looking dated or overly traditional, instead opting for modern lines that speak to efficiency and innovation. The weight of the font is bold enough to convey authority but legible enough to be welcoming.
PermataBank Color Palette
The color scheme is a vital component of the PermataBank logo and its psychological impact on consumers. The brand utilizes a monochromatic blue palette that is synonymous with the financial industry, representing trust, intelligence, and security.
- Permata Azure (Primary Brand Color): This vivid shade of blue represents energy, clarity, and the digital forward-thinking nature of the bank. It captures the brilliance of a sapphire gem.
- Corporate Navy (Secondary/Dark): Used for text and deeper accents, this dark blue grounds the brand, providing a sense of established authority and corporate stability.
- Canvas White (Background/Accent): White is used to provide negative space, ensuring the blue elements pop. It reinforces the themes of transparency and purity inherent in the "Permata" name.
